You'll often find one-piece swimsuits, which are a staple for many swimmers, especially those who are active or compete. These suits are known for their secure fit and the support they offer. iipseiswimsuitsse often designs their one-pieces with competitive swimmers in mind, featuring streamlined cuts and durable fabrics that can withstand hours of training. Look out for styles with features like medium or high leg cuts, and supportive straps – these are designed to stay put no matter how vigorous your swim.

For those who prioritize coverage and sun protection, iipseiswimsuitsse could also offer jammer-style swimsuits or aquashorts. These are essentially longer shorts that extend down the thigh, providing extra coverage and reducing drag. They are incredibly popular among male swimmers for training and racing, and iipseiswimsuitsse often produces them with a focus on muscle support and hydrodynamic design.
